Semana Santa is definitely the Holy Week celebrated in between Palm Sunday and Easter Sunday, with Seville getting among the list of metropolitan areas in Spain the place it truly is celebrated most fanatically. For the duration of this week, the town is completely turned upside down with impressive processions of the brotherhoods, wearing putting robes with pointed hats, carrying their sacred statues and richly decorated altars with Jesus or Mary in the metropolis in direction of the cathedral. Through the entire Semana Santa, dozens of such processions happen in the center.

[109] Right after Don Fadrique Enriquez de Ribera returned from the pilgrimage to Jerusalem in 1520, he commissioned a stone portal at the doorway of the relatives mansion. The portal became the starting point for the By way of Crucis to your Cruz del Campo, and later on writers claimed it had been modeled around the doorway of the home of Pontius Pilate from the Holy Land, So earning the house its existing title.[109][108]

The Hospital de los Venerables is often a baroque 17th-century elaborate in the middle of the Santa Cruz district that at first served to care for the aged and the lousy and later for a residence for clergymen. The accompanying church has wonderful frescoes made by the Valdés relatives as well as the central patio is likewise really worth a check out.
